R. Johnson Prabakaran is a highly experienced aviation professional with more than 36 years of distinguished service in corporate and international flight operations. With over 9,300 flight hours across jet, turboprop, and piston aircraft, he brings extensive expertise in executive aviation, flight safety, crew evaluation, and operational leadership.
Holding both FAA and Indian ATPL certifications, Capt. Prabakaran has served as an executive pilot for some of India's leading corporate organizations, including Lakshmi Machine Works, TVS Motor Company, Larsen & Toubro, and India Cements. His professional journey reflects exceptional standards of safety, precision, confidentiality, and operational excellence in high-profile corporate aviation environments.
As a certified Check Pilot and former Chief of Flight Safety, he has played a key role in crew assessment, aviation safety management, and airworthiness oversight. His international flying experience spans more than 25 countries across multiple continents, demonstrating strong expertise in global aviation operations and regulatory compliance. Known for his disciplined approach, technical proficiency, and commitment to aviation safety, he continues to contribute valuable leadership and insight in corporate aviation, flight operations, and safety consultancy services.
